{"title":"Research on Network Simulation Abstract Technology Based on Simplicity Theory","authors":"Jia Wang, Xiangzhan Yu, Jun Yan","doi":"10.1109/WNIS.2009.10","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/WNIS.2009.10","url":null,"abstract":"Given a large scale internet, how can we derive a representative simplifying topology model by network simulation? There are many known algorithms to compute interesting measures (scale down the number of clients, deletion methods, contraction methods, et al.), but most of them only reduce the scale of the network topology, the facticity of network simulation results can’t be guaranteed. So when simplifying network topology and reducing the simulation complexity, we should not only consider the reduction of network scale but also consider the actual simulation application and the facticity of simulation result.Given that, this paper proposes a network topology simplicity method based on focus-zone with Weight Forest Fire(WFF) , which can greatly reduce the scale of network topology and guarantee the facticity of simulation results. Then through sampling network topology experiment and UDP worm simulation experiment, it can be known that this method can not only maintain the topological properties of original topology but also improve the efficiency of network simulation by 11%. And the maximum error of the packet drop ratio is 7.8%, which occurred at the sampling rate of 0.5.","PeriodicalId":280001,"journal":{"name":"2009 International Conference on Wireless Networks and Information Systems","volume":"12 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2009-12-28","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"127966859","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

{"title":"The Research of Coverage Problems in Wireless Sensor Network","authors":"Yuling Lei, Yan Zhang, Yanjuan Zhao","doi":"10.1109/WNIS.2009.38","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/WNIS.2009.38","url":null,"abstract":"Wireless sensor network is composed by wireless sensor nodes, which have capabilities of perception, computing and communication. Network coverage is the main support technology in wireless sensor network application; it can achieve the physical information perception of the target region and the target object through the spatial distribution of sensor nodes in the network. Network coverage fundamentally reflects the network’s perception ability for physical world. In addition, it largely affects the cost of the network and the performance of specific application. Network coverage is to be the most important issues in the network design.We first introduce simple coverage model of the wireless sensor network in this paper, and next, we discuss the challenges which belong to the issue of network coverage. In this paper, we describe the classification of coverage issues in detail.","PeriodicalId":280001,"journal":{"name":"2009 International Conference on Wireless Networks and Information Systems","volume":"20 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2009-12-28","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"131595298","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

{"title":"Antecedents of Knowledge Transfer in E-learning","authors":"Hanyang Luo","doi":"10.1109/WNIS.2009.97","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/WNIS.2009.97","url":null,"abstract":"This research examines the antecedents of knowledge transfer from teachers to students in E-learning. Drawing from the E-learning and knowledge transfer literatures, we develop an integrated theoretical model that posits that knowledge transfer is influenced by four sets of factors: knowledge-related, transfer contextual, teacher-related and student-related aspects. Data were collected from respondent teachers and students using online questionnaire. The results of the analysis demonstrate that all four aspects have a significant influence on knowledge transfer in E-learning, and provide support for 8 of the 9 hypotheses. The analysis also confirms four mediating relationships. These research results extend, augment, and apply prior research to an increasingly prevailed E-learning domain. Our research contributes to theory and practice in E-learning by focusing on knowledge transfer as the crucial aspect and integrating theory developed in other knowledge transfer contexts.","PeriodicalId":280001,"journal":{"name":"2009 International Conference on Wireless Networks and Information Systems","volume":"1 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2009-12-28","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"123726673","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}
